What does Attica Bank do?

Attica Bank SA is a Greek bank founded in 1925 with its headquarters in Athens. The bank aims to provide its customers with a wide range of financial services while guaranteeing reliable and transparent solutions. The bank originated from the "Panellinio Etaireia Prothesmias" of the National Bank of Greece, which was founded in 1918-1919. The idea of establishing a specialized bank focused on the needs of small and medium-sized enterprises was first proposed in 1923 by economist Frangiskos Vrachnos. Attica Bank was eventually founded in 1925 and quickly became one of the leading banks in Greece. Attica Bank specializes in serving the needs of small and medium-sized enterprises. Its business model is based on providing customized financing solutions tailored to the customers' needs. The bank offers a wide range of financial products, including loans, deposits, securities services, and payment solutions. The bank strives to provide each customer with individual and tailored solutions that meet their specific needs and requirements. Attica Bank operates in five main business sectors: 1. Retail banking: The bank offers a variety of financial products and services to retail customers, including deposits, loans, and credit cards. 2. Corporate banking: Attica Bank is involved in providing financing solutions for small and medium-sized enterprises in Greece, including loans, overdraft facilities, and leasing options. 3. Real estate: Attica Bank offers a wide range of services in real estate financing and investments. 4. Investment management: The bank provides professional asset management and fund management services. 5. Investment banking: The bank is active in the field of underwriting and stock issuances, offering financial advisory services to its clients across the entire spectrum of financing. Attica Bank offers a wide range of products and services, including loans (such as mortgage loans, car loans, and business loans), deposits (including standard and higher interest savings accounts), securities services (such as stock and bond trading and fund management), credit cards (including Visa and Mastercard), and leasing services to assist business customers in financing vehicles, machinery, and other assets. Understanding Attica Bank's Return on Assets (ROA)

Attica Bank's Return on Assets (ROA) is a key performance indicator that measures the company's profitability in relation to its total assets. It is calculated by dividing the net income by the total assets. A higher ROA indicates efficient asset utilization to generate profits, reflecting managerial effectiveness and financial health.

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
